Witryna1 dzień temu · Preoperative evaluation of axillary lymph node (ALN) status is an essential part of deciding the appropriate treatment. According to ACOSOG Z0011 trials, the new goal of the ALN status evaluation is tumor burden (low burden, < 3 positive ALNs; high burden, ≥ 3 positive ALNs), instead of metastasis or non-metastasis. WitrynaOn the basis of review of multiple online breast imaging forums, including the Society of Breast Imaging's open forum for member radiologists (SBI Connect), breast … WitrynaWe report the largest sample to our knowledge of COVID-19 vaccine associated axillary adenopathy on imaging. A total of 87% of cases were detected incidentally in asymptomatic women. The adenopathy was detected on screening imaging in 50% of these women. Follow-up imaging or biopsy was recommended in all but one patient.
